THE DALLES, Ore. (AP) — Authorities say one person was critically injured after a classic car driver accelerated quickly in The Dalles, flipped over and struck several people who were watching nearby. According to The Dalles Police Department, police responded to the incident around 10 p.m. Saturday. Investigators say the driver of a 1955 Chevy Bel-Air, Ronald Madorin, rapidly accelerated from a stop light after the light turned green. Police say the Chevy Bel-Air flipped over, struck a parked vehicle and injured people who were watching the classic car cruise. One person suffered critical injuries and was taken to the hospital. The Chevy Bel-Air burst into flames after the crash. Madorin suffered minor injuries. After his release from Mid-Columbia Medical Center, Madorin was arrested on charges of second-degree assault. Other charges may be filed later. Police do not think alcohol was a factor.
Madorin is scheduled to appear in Wasco County Circuit Court this afternoon at 1:15. His current bail is set at $100,000.
